grpc客户端超时(grpc客户端重连机制)

菲律宾亚星开户 38 2

1、GRPC是一种远程过程调用RPC框架,它允许客户端和服务器之间的高效通信GRPC检查是指对GRPC应用程序进行检查以确保其正常运行这个过程包括检查连接是否正常,协议是否正确,客户端和服务器之间的通信是否稳定等如果出现任何问题,将会对应用程序的性能和稳定性产生负面影响因此,在生产环境中,进行GRPC。

2、gRPC框架通过LoadBalance功能实现这一目标,当请求到达客户端时,系统根据预设策略选择一个服务节点进行处理例如,使用RoundRobin策略,客户端在请求到达时,会选择合适的服务节点进行转发处理,确保所有服务节点均得到充分利用,同时提升系统性能与稳定性总结,Retry与LoadBalance是gRPC框架中不可或缺的特性。

3、元数据是用于特定 RPC 调用的键值对列表,包含如身份验证等信息通道提供连接至指定主机和端口上的 gRPC 服务,用于创建客户端存根gRPC 支持通道状态和关闭逻辑,以及超时取消和错误处理机制为了开始使用 gRPC,需要安装 Protocol Buffer 编译器插件和 Go 语言的 gRPC 插件然后创建测试项目,定义。

4、创建Picker,Picker执行的算法就是真正的LB逻辑,当客户端使用conn初始化PRC方法时,通过Picker选择一个存活的连接,返回给客户端,然后调用UpdatePicker更新LB算法的内置状态,为下一次调用做准备 Balaner是gRPC负载均衡最核心的模块 据此,我们可用通过自定义的Balancer,在Balaner基础上通过实现自定义的namingResolver来达到使用。

grpc客户端超时(grpc客户端重连机制)-第1张图片-亚星国际官网

5、当然,grpc单次数据传输的大小限制是可以修改的,但是不建议你这么做默认最大消息大小为4MB 不断修改增加服务端和客户端消息大小,每次请求不一定需要全部数据,会导致性能上和资源上的浪费grpc协议层是基于。

grpc客户端超时(grpc客户端重连机制)-第1张图片-亚星国际官网

6、为服务选择IPC时,需考虑交互模式一对一一个客户端请求对应一个服务实例响应或一对多一个客户端请求对应多个服务实例响应交互模式又分为同步客户端请求等待服务端即时响应,可能阻塞和异步客户端请求不阻塞进程,服务端响应可能非即时基于消息通信的优点包括解耦客户端和服务端,无。

grpc客户端超时(grpc客户端重连机制)-第1张图片-亚星国际官网

7、gRPC是一种非常适合微信小程序开发的通信方式微信小程序开发者可以使用gRPC在客户端和服务端之间进行高效可靠的通信,而且支持多种语言之间的通信,对于跨语言开发的小程序非常友好使用gRPC在微信小程序开发中,可以提高通信效率,加速数据传输和处理,并且可以更好地控制数据传输,保证数据安全性和稳定性。

8、可以截至2023年6月7日,使用grpc双向模式,可以实现客户端随时发送消息给服务端,服务端也可以随时发送消息到客户端,不再是一问一答的模式。

grpc客户端超时(grpc客户端重连机制)-第1张图片-亚星国际官网

9、RPCRemote Procedure Call Protocol远程过程调用协议,让客户端如同调用本地方法一样发起远程调用,适用于分布式系统进程间通信gRPC 是一个基于。

grpc客户端超时(grpc客户端重连机制)-第1张图片-亚星国际官网

10、很多人都质疑PB的这个行为,然而这并不能改变什么,下面是一个关于该问题的回答,大意就是JS使用了52bit去实现IEEE754的双精度数,也就是说js在不丢失信息的情况下最大能表示的数是 2^52 64位的数在JS中直接使用是会有问题了PB为了客户端能正常处理数据而把64位数值直接转换为了string类型。

11、特别提到的是gRPC,一个基于。

12、使用gRPC PHP客户端,确保你已经安装了示例client_testphp 运行后输出常见问题 1CentOS6使用 go mod获取第三方依赖包unknown revision xxx错误 解决其实go mod调用链中会用到一些git指令,当git版本比较旧时,调用失败产生错误,并给出歧义的提示信息方法就是升级git版本,CentOS6自带的git是。

grpc客户端超时(grpc客户端重连机制)-第1张图片-亚星国际官网

13、与传统协议如Thrift相比,gRPC在。

14、gRPC是一种高效快速和轻量级的远程过程调用RPC框架它是由Google开发的开源框架,支持多种编程语言,如JavaC++Python等使用gRPC可以轻松地在客户端和服务端之间传输数据,让开发人员能够更加方便和高效地构建分布式系统gRPC的优点包括高效性可靠性和扩展性等方面对于高并发低延迟带宽。

15、本文介绍Goreplay如何支持GRPC,首先,GRPC是谷歌研发的基于。

标签: grpc客户端超时

发表评论 (已有2条评论)

评论列表

2024-12-26 23:17:15

请求到达时,会选择合适的服务节点进行转发处理,确保所有服务节点均得到充分利用,同时提升系统性能与稳定性总结,Retry与LoadBalance是gRPC框架中不可或缺的特性。3、元数据是用于特定 RPC 调用的键值对列表,包含如身份验

2024-12-27 06:18:18

tOS6使用 go mod获取第三方依赖包unknown revision xxx错误 解决其实go mod调用链中会用到一些git指令,当git版本比较旧时,调用失败产生错误,并给出歧义的提示信息方法就是升级git版本,Ce